A career that gives you more

Your career at NAB is about more than money, it's about serving our customers well and helping our communities prosper. We currently have multiple opportunities available for customer-focused individuals to join our team.

As a Customer Operations Team Member, you'll be joining a flexible and multi-skilled team whose core focus is to ensure our customer experience is of the highest standard. You'll undertake various business placements aligned to supporting our customers and bankers. Whilst each placement may differ in length, each will provide you with the valuable product, systems and lending knowledge that are foundational for building your banking career at NAB.

In order to build the required skills and capabilities to succeed at NAB, Customer Operations Team Members will gain experience in various parts of the customer journey. The placements will be centred on servicing our customers within both contact centres and various back-office teams. Placements may include supporting customers calling our contact centre with everyday banking needs, assisting customers who may be experiencing vulnerability in managing their financial obligations, loan document preparation, settlements, drawdown and post-settlement activities.

At least one placement will be in one of NAB's Contact Centre Teams where you will learn our core products and systems by providing support to customers over the phone. This placement will require you to work a rotating roster between Monday – Friday 8 am – 7 pm, Saturday 7 am – 6 pm & Sunday 9 am – 6 pm.

Pros and cons of working at NAB Australia

Pros

  • Amazing Culture and People. Employees are valued and recognised for the hard work that they put in. The company has a very supportive environment and has many different learning and development opportunities available."

  • Flexible working (WFH), emphasis on work-life balance. Big organisation so lots of areas to get involved in and explore.

  • Great learning opportunities - 3-4 rotations depending on your dream to get exposure to different parts of the bank. Good work-life balance.

  • Employees are recognised for the hard work and initiative that they take which gives them the opportunity to further our career development.

  • The graduate culture is amazing and everyone is very social and happy to catch up.

Cons

    • Sometimes we have to navigate lots of old tech and systems.

    • Because it’s such a large organization, it can be tricky to know the ins and outs of what each function does, but that comes with time, experience and exposure.

    • Sometimes have to work long hours.

    • There were lots of stages of the interview process

    • We don’t get any bonuses. Apparently they used to but they stopped a few years back.
